navicat
-
mysql客户端安装后如何设置审计_mysql客户端审计功能设置教程
要实现MySQL客户端操作审计,需在服务端配置审计插件。首先确认MySQL支持审计功能,通过SHOW PLUGINS检查是否启用;若未启用,以McAfee Audit Plugin为例,下载并安装对应平台的so文件至插件目录,执行INSTALL PLUGIN AUDIT SONAME加载插件;随后配…
-
mysql密码修改后数据库怎么验证_mysql数据库验证密码修改是否成功
答案是通过新密码成功登录MySQL、确认用户表中密码哈希更新、应用连接正常且执行FLUSH PRIVILEGES刷新权限后,验证密码修改成功。 修改MySQL密码后,验证是否成功的关键是通过新的密码重新连接数据库,并检查用户凭证状态。以下是具体操作步骤和验证方法。 使用新密码登录验证 最直接的验证方…
-
mysql密码验证怎么通过_mysql密码验证通过后修改新密码
MySQL通过校验mysql.user表中的哈希值完成密码验证,登录后可用ALTER USER、SET PASSWORD等命令修改密码,需注意版本差异与密码策略要求。 在MySQL中,密码验证是通过身份认证机制完成的,当你连接数据库时输入密码,系统会校验该密码是否正确。验证通过后,你可以使用SQL命…
-
数据库开发集成:VSCode中SQL编辑与查询优化
答案:VSCode通过配置数据库扩展、语法高亮与智能提示搭建SQL开发环境,结合代码片段、格式化与多光标编辑提升编写效率,利用执行计划查看和慢查询标记优化性能,并集成Git实现版本控制与团队协作,构建高效可维护的SQL工作流。 在现代数据库开发中,VSCode凭借其轻量、灵活和强大的扩展生态,已成为…
-
mysql如何配置远程访问权限_mysql远程访问权限配置
要让MySQL支持远程访问,需修改bind-address为0.0.0.0以监听所有IP,重启MySQL服务;再通过GRANT命令授权用户从%或指定IP远程登录,并执行FLUSH PRIVILEGES刷新权限;最后确保防火墙或云安全组开放3306端口,方可成功远程连接。 要让MySQL支持远程访问,…
-
mysql如何连接远程服务器_mysql远程连接的设置与常见问题
要让MySQL支持远程连接,需修改bind-address为0.0.0.0,授权用户从%或指定IP访问,并开放3306端口的防火墙和安全组规则。 要让MySQL支持远程连接,需要从服务器配置、用户权限和网络环境三方面进行设置。很多开发者在本地测试时使用localhost访问数据库没问题,但换到远程连…
-
mysql如何导入大型sql文件_mysql导入大型sql文件的高效技巧分享
使用命令行导入并优化MySQL配置可高效处理大SQL文件。具体步骤:1. 用mysql命令直接导入避免图形工具性能瓶颈;2. 调整disable-autocommit、innodb_flush_log_at_trx_commit等参数提升速度;3. 用split命令分割超大文件分批导入;4. 将IN…
-
SQL经典50题答案
SQL(结构化查询语言)是一种编程语言,用于创建、管理和查询数据库。主要功能包括:创建数据库和表、插入、更新和删除数据、排序和过滤结果、聚合函数、连接表、子查询、运算符、函数、关键字、数据操纵/定义/控制语言、连接类型、查询优化、安全性、工具、资源、版本、常见错误、调试技巧、最佳实践、趋势和行锁定。…
-
什么是SQL的DROP语句?删除数据库对象的正确方法
DROP语句用于彻底删除数据库对象,如表、数据库、视图等,其本质是DDL操作,不可回滚,执行后对象及其结构和数据均被永久移除。与DELETE(删除行数据,可回滚)和TRUNCATE(清空表数据,速度快但不可回滚)不同,DROP作用于对象本身,是最彻底但也最危险的操作。使用时需谨慎,常见陷阱包括误删、…
-
我的Mac应用清单
子曰:“工欲善其事,必先利其器”。 为什么选择Mac 许多人可能会问:Mac有什么特别之处?在相同或更低的价格下,可以购买配置更高的Windows电脑。首先,Mac系统基于Unix系统,运行更加稳定和流畅。此外,Mac的显示屏清晰度极高,使用时非常舒适,特别是MacBook Pro。其次,Mac的续…